KREWE is an independent, high-fashion eyewear brand rooted in the vibrant culture and boundless creativity of our hometown, New Orleans - and now proudly headquartered in both New Orleans and New York City. Since our launch in 2013, KREWE has grown into a dynamic brand celebrated for its distinctive, handcrafted sun and optical frames that reflect a deep commitment to quality,  individuality, and design.

In 2022, we opened the doors to our NYC headquarters in the heart of the Meatpacking District, building a second home for the brand that brings New Orleans’ culture, creativity, and energy to one of the world’s most iconic design capitals. Our presence now spans brick-and-morter boutiques, mobile retail concepts, and a thriving e-commerce platform - alongside distribution through premier independents and top national retailers. We are currently searching for a Quality Control and Fulfillment Associate to join a team of smart creatives further expanding our ability to drive brand growth through product quality assurance and on time and accurate delivery of our product. 

This role will report to the Director of Customer Service and Fulfillment to support both product quality auditing and product fulfillment execution. The role is responsible for executing the inspection and testing of inbound products; picking, packing and shipping B2B and DTC orders; and evaluating returned goods to ensure product saleability. This is a hybrid role that will play a critical role in upholding KREWE brand standards. Time spent in each area of the job will vary depending on the needs of the business. Agility, a keen attention to detail and a strong work ethic will play a critical part in the success of this role.

This role is based in our New Orleans Headquarters 5 days a week.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Perform Quality inspections on KREWE products to ensure compliance with standards and specifications. Inspections will apply to inbound products, returned goods, and will include a variety of existing and new product categories. 
  • Create, update and maintain quality data and inspection activity in a timely manner and document within NetSuite, Excel, Monday.com or other identified QC system as required.
  • Report to management on QC Inspection results and KPI’s as required.
  • Create and maintain files for inspection standards for current and future products.
  • Create and maintain an organized QC work area such that products are easily and readily identifiable. Maintains standards of organization and cleanliness throughout all workspaces. Keeps all shared and personal areas clean and tidy. 
  • Ensure all returned goods are restocked systematically and restored to sellable condition according to brand standards. 
  • Ensure that defective and unusable products are documented and dispositioned properly in accordance with damaged goods procedures.
  • Pick and pack e-commerce, wholesale and store restock orders accurately and efficiently according to KREWE brand guidelines. Ability to read a pick ticket or order. Pick/pack correct product(s) quickly and accurately
  • Prepare packaging containers for all order types. Ensure quality standards are maintained on all outgoing orders
  • Product Knowledge and Location Expertise: Ability to identify products accurately by sight and barcode; awareness of all product locations (forward pick and backstock locations). 
  • Executes other fulfillment-related duties as needed: ensures all outbound shipments are picked up daily; takes part in inventory hard counts and cycle counts; executes bin restocks.
  • Communicates with team members calmly and effectively. Communicates any questions to the manager in a timely manner.  
  • Follows all company safety standards.
  • Assist in special projects as needed within the department depending on business needs.
